Punjab Floods: 26,250 People Evacuated to Safe Places

  • 168 Relief Camps Active in Flood-Affected Areas

 

Chandigarh, July 18, 2023: The Punjab government has evacuated 26,250 people to safe places in the wake of the recent floods. The floods have affected 1422 villages in 18 districts of the state.

 

A spokesperson for the government said that 168 relief camps have been set up in the affected areas. These camps are providing food, shelter, and medical care to the displaced people.

 

The spokesperson said that the government is working to restore normalcy in the affected areas. The National Disaster Response Force (NDRF) and the State Disaster Response Force (SDRF) have been deployed to help with the relief and rescue operations.

 

The spokesperson appealed to the people to stay safe and follow the instructions of the authorities.
